The root chakra, also known as the Muladhara chakra, is located at the base of the spine and is considered to be the foundation of the entire chakra system. It is associated with the color red and is responsible for our sense of safety, security, and stability. When the root chakra is balanced, we feel grounded, centered, and connected to the earth. However, when it is imbalanced, we may experience feelings of fear, anxiety, and insecurity. In this article, we will explore the importance of balancing your root chakra and how it can improve your overall well-being. 

 What is the Root Chakra?


The root chakra is the first chakra in the body and is responsible for our sense of safety and security. It is associated with the earth element and is located at the base of the spine. The root chakra is also associated with the adrenal glands, which are responsible for our fight or flight response. 

When the root chakra is balanced, we feel grounded, stable, and secure. However, when it is imbalanced, we may experience feelings of fear, anxiety, and insecurity. 

Signs of an Imbalanced Root Chakra 

 An imbalanced root chakra can manifest in many ways, both physically and emotionally. 

Some common signs of an imbalanced root chakra include: 

  • Feelings of fear, anxiety, and insecurity 
  • Lack of trust in oneself and others 
  • Difficulty making decisions
  • Feeling disconnected from one's body 
  • Chronic fatigue and lack of energy 
  • Digestive issues 
  • Lower back pain 
  • Knee and foot problems
  • Issues with the adrenal glands 

If you are experiencing any of these symptoms, it may be a sign that your root chakra is imbalanced and in need of balancing. 


How to Balance Your Root Chakra

There are many ways to balance your root chakra, including: 

 1. Grounding exercises: Grounding exercises involve connecting with the earth and can help to balance the root chakra. Some grounding exercises include walking barefoot on the earth, sitting or lying on the ground, and practicing yoga or tai chi. 

 2. Meditation: Meditation is a powerful tool for balancing the chakras, including the root chakra. There are many guided meditations available that focus specifically on the root chakra.

 3. Aromatherapy: Essential oils can be used to balance the chakras, including the root chakra. Some essential oils that are beneficial for the root chakra include cedarwood, frankincense, and patchouli. 

 4. Yoga: Yoga is a great way to balance the chakras, including the root chakra. Some yoga poses that are beneficial for the root chakra include mountain pose, tree pose, and warrior pose. 

 5. Crystals: Crystals can be used to balance the chakras, including the root chakra. Some crystals that are beneficial for the root chakra include red jasper, hematite, and black tourmaline.

What is Chakra Meditation?

Chakra meditation is a form of meditation that focuses on the seven energy centers, or chakras, located throughout the body. These chakras are believed to be responsible for the flow of energy, or prana, throughout the body. When these chakras are blocked or imbalanced, it can lead to physical, emotional, and spiritual issues.

Chakra meditation is a powerful tool for clearing, balancing, and charging the chakras, which can lead to improved physical health, emotional well-being, and spiritual growth. In this article, we will explore the definition of chakra meditation and how it can benefit your life. 


What is Chakra Meditation? 


Chakra meditation is a form of meditation that focuses on the seven energy centers, or chakras, located throughout the body. These chakras are believed to be responsible for the flow of energy, or prana, throughout the body. 

Each chakra is associated with a different color, sound, and aspect of our being. When these chakras are blocked or imbalanced, it can lead to physical, emotional, and spiritual issues. 

Chakra meditation is a powerful tool for clearing, balancing, and charging the chakras. By doing so, we can improve our physical health, emotional well-being, and spiritual growth. 

Chakra meditation involves visualizing each chakra as a spinning wheel of energy, with its associated color and sound. By focusing on each chakra and visualizing it spinning at the appropriate speed and emitting its associated color and sound, we can clear any blockages or negative energy from that chakra, balance the energy in that chakra, and charge it with positive energy.

Chakras for Beginners

Chakras for Beginners


The concept of chakras has been around for thousands of years, and it is an integral part of many spiritual and metaphysical practices. In this article, we will explore the history of chakras, their function in metaphysical health, and how they can be used for psychic protection by both beginners and advanced new age practitioners. 


What are Chakras? 

Chakras are energy centers in the body that are believed to be responsible for the flow of energy throughout the body. There are seven main chakras, each located in a specific area of the body, and each associated with a different color, element, and function. 

The seven main chakras are: 

1. Root Chakra - located at the base of the spine, associated with the color red, and responsible for grounding and stability. 

 2. Sacral Chakra - located in the lower abdomen, associated with the color orange, and responsible for creativity and sexuality. 

 3. Solar Plexus Chakra - located in the upper abdomen, associated with the color yellow, and responsible for personal power and self-esteem. 

 4. Heart Chakra - located in the center of the chest, associated with the color green, and responsible for love and compassion. 

 5. Throat Chakra - located in the throat, associated with the color blue, and responsible for communication and self-expression. 

 6. Third Eye Chakra - located in the center of the forehead, associated with the color indigo, and responsible for intuition and spiritual insight. 

 7. Crown Chakra - located at the top of the head, associated with the color violet, and responsible for spiritual connection and enlightenment. 


The History of Chakras 


The concept of chakras originated in ancient India, where they were first mentioned in the Vedas, the oldest texts in Hinduism. The word chakra comes from the Sanskrit word for "wheel" or "circle," and it refers to the spinning energy centers in the body. 

The chakra system was further developed in the Tantric tradition of Hinduism, where it was used as a tool for spiritual growth and enlightenment. The chakras were believed to be connected to the subtle body, which is the energy body that surrounds and interpenetrates the physical body. 

The chakra system was also adopted by Buddhism, where it was used as a tool for meditation and spiritual development. In Buddhism, the chakras were believed to be connected to the subtle body, which is the energy body that is composed of the five elements: earth, water, fire, air, and space (or ether). 

The chakra system was later adopted by the new age movement, where it is used as a tool for spiritual growth, healing, and psychic protection.
